Four Seasons Leeuwarden 3.12

5 star(s) from 5 votes
Lieuwenburg 134
Leeuwarden,
Netherlands

About Four Seasons Leeuwarden

Four Seasons Leeuwarden Four Seasons Leeuwarden is a well known place listed as Shopping/retail in Leeuwarden , Women's Clothing Store in Leeuwarden ,

Contact Details & Working Hours